Latest Patents

Toru Ishitaka holds a patent for a "Switching power supply device, and adjustable power supply system including the same." This invention features a rectifying circuit that receives a phase-controlled alternating voltage and converts it into a direct voltage. The switching operation conversion circuit is designed to start up when the direct voltage is applied. It includes a normally on type switching element that allows input current to pass and an off driving circuit that turns off the switching element when the input current reaches a prescribed value. This technology effectively converts the direct voltage into an output voltage that differs from the input by repeatedly switching the element on and off.
